Transaction bf8127bf38ed5acf3da3a360765815621aec113eefd2854d73cdc7dd8f61e52c
1 Input
1 Output
-
bf8127bf38ed5acf3da3a360765815621aec113eefd2854d73cdc7dd8f61e52c:0
- value
- 690315
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abe07fe3c45a37e565f1671f21e5f448d517b655 OP_EQUAL
- address
- 3HMpQrGcCKxWDsDbhRJBdjnjM8d5W3Z3gx